Default Broken cable in rear seat, anyone know how to access???

I folded down my rear seat the other day and it wouldn't unfold. I took it to Lexus and they wanted $600 to replace a broken cable in the seat. After that estimate I decided to do it myself. I found the parts I need on Sewell for about $50. The problem is that I am having a hard time getting access to the cables in the seat. Does anyone know how to get access to the cables in the seat or how to remove it so I can figure it out from there?

First, lay the rear seats down flat and folded over. Then to the left and right of each folding seat you will see a visible panel in the sides of the vehicle that easily open. Then get a socket wrench with an extension and simply remove the two bolts per each seat. You can then easily lift the complete seat assembly out of the rear of the car. I would recommend that you thread the bolts back into the plates so you will not lose them and then replace the panel.
